DAILY GUIDANCE AND PRESS SCHEDULE FORTHURSDAY, MAY 24, 2012

In the morning, the President will attend a campaign event at the Fairmont Hotel in San Jose, California. This event is closed press.

Later in the morning, the President will travel to Newton, Iowa. The departure from Moffett Federal Airfield and the arrival at Des Moines International Airport are open press.

While in Newton, the President will tour and deliver remarks at TPI Composites, a wind manufacturer where he will urge Congress to act on the “To Do List,” specifically highlighting the need to invest in clean energy by passing legislation that will extend the Production Tax Credit (PTC) to support American jobs and manufacturing in the wind industry alongside an expansion of the 48C Advanced Energy Manufacturing Tax Credit that supports American-made clean energy manufacturing. There will be travel pool coverage of the tour and the President’s remarks are open press. 

In the afternoon, the President will travel to Des Moines, Iowa for a campaign event. This event is open press.

In the evening, the President will return to Washington, DC. The departure from Des Moines International Airport and the arrival on the South Lawn are open press.
